New photos on jacobsonphoto.com Web Site

Yes, this is a self-serving message but possibly of some interest to members of this site. We have long been distracted by various projects, particularly on a book about John Ruskin’s daguerreotypes, but have just added more than 160 new photographs to our web site. We hope there will be images to provoke study and possibly delight even for those among you who are unlikely to purchase. Furthermore, the site has useful information for collectors and researchers of 19th century photography: links to other web sites; advice to collectors; a bibliography; a suggested system for describing the condition of photographic prints and a glossary of printing processes.
